Refactored the whole RobotUnit (split it in modules, cleaned up code, added...
Refactored the whole RobotUnit (split it in modules, cleaned up code, added doxygen, removed undefined behavior, reduced data sharing)
Showing
- source/RobotAPI/components/units/RobotUnit/CMakeLists.txt 91 additions, 4 deletionssource/RobotAPI/components/units/RobotUnit/CMakeLists.txt
- source/RobotAPI/components/units/RobotUnit/ControlTargets/ControlTargetBase.h 32 additions, 57 deletions...onents/units/RobotUnit/ControlTargets/ControlTargetBase.h
- source/RobotAPI/components/units/RobotUnit/Devices/RTThreadTimingsSensorDevice.h 5 additions, 0 deletions...nts/units/RobotUnit/Devices/RTThreadTimingsSensorDevice.h
- source/RobotAPI/components/units/RobotUnit/NJointControllers/NJointCartesianTorqueController.cpp 6 additions, 8 deletions...nit/NJointControllers/NJointCartesianTorqueController.cpp
- source/RobotAPI/components/units/RobotUnit/NJointControllers/NJointCartesianTorqueController.h 2 additions, 2 deletions...tUnit/NJointControllers/NJointCartesianTorqueController.h
- source/RobotAPI/components/units/RobotUnit/NJointControllers/NJointCartesianVelocityController.cpp 6 additions, 8 deletions...t/NJointControllers/NJointCartesianVelocityController.cpp
- source/RobotAPI/components/units/RobotUnit/NJointControllers/NJointCartesianVelocityController.h 2 additions, 2 deletions...nit/NJointControllers/NJointCartesianVelocityController.h
- source/RobotAPI/components/units/RobotUnit/NJointControllers/NJointController.cpp 234 additions, 144 deletions...ts/units/RobotUnit/NJointControllers/NJointController.cpp
- source/RobotAPI/components/units/RobotUnit/NJointControllers/NJointController.h 101 additions, 88 deletions...ents/units/RobotUnit/NJointControllers/NJointController.h
- source/RobotAPI/components/units/RobotUnit/NJointControllers/NJointController.ipp 38 additions, 25 deletions...ts/units/RobotUnit/NJointControllers/NJointController.ipp
- source/RobotAPI/components/units/RobotUnit/NJointControllers/NJointHolonomicPlatformUnitVelocityPassThroughController.cpp 2 additions, 2 deletions...intHolonomicPlatformUnitVelocityPassThroughController.cpp
- source/RobotAPI/components/units/RobotUnit/NJointControllers/NJointHolonomicPlatformUnitVelocityPassThroughController.h 1 addition, 1 deletion...JointHolonomicPlatformUnitVelocityPassThroughController.h
- source/RobotAPI/components/units/RobotUnit/NJointControllers/NJointKinematicUnitPassThroughController.cpp 3 additions, 3 deletions...tControllers/NJointKinematicUnitPassThroughController.cpp
- source/RobotAPI/components/units/RobotUnit/NJointControllers/NJointKinematicUnitPassThroughController.h 1 addition, 1 deletion...intControllers/NJointKinematicUnitPassThroughController.h
- source/RobotAPI/components/units/RobotUnit/NJointControllers/NJointTCPController.cpp 7 additions, 8 deletions...units/RobotUnit/NJointControllers/NJointTCPController.cpp
- source/RobotAPI/components/units/RobotUnit/NJointControllers/NJointTCPController.h 2 additions, 2 deletions...s/units/RobotUnit/NJointControllers/NJointTCPController.h
- source/RobotAPI/components/units/RobotUnit/NJointControllers/NJointTrajectoryController.cpp 3 additions, 3 deletions...obotUnit/NJointControllers/NJointTrajectoryController.cpp
- source/RobotAPI/components/units/RobotUnit/NJointControllers/NJointTrajectoryController.h 1 addition, 1 deletion.../RobotUnit/NJointControllers/NJointTrajectoryController.h
- source/RobotAPI/components/units/RobotUnit/RobotSynchronization.cpp 0 additions, 78 deletions...otAPI/components/units/RobotUnit/RobotSynchronization.cpp
- source/RobotAPI/components/units/RobotUnit/RobotUnit.cpp 0 additions, 3270 deletionssource/RobotAPI/components/units/RobotUnit/RobotUnit.cpp
Loading
Please register or sign in to comment